Did you know that despite being a central figure and captain for over a decade at West Ham, Mark Noble never made a single senior appearance for the England national team?
Mark Noble's most defining career moment was his long-standing captaincy and unwavering leadership of West Ham United, which saw the club maintain a consistent Premier League presence and achieve European qualification. His emotional farewell at the London Stadium after 18 years underscored his deep connection to the club and its loyal fanbase.
Mark Noble's legacy is that of the ultimate 'one-club man,' a symbol of unwavering loyalty and dedication to West Ham United, embodying the club's spirit and passion for generations of fans.
